如何在esri中创建具有其他不同颜色的Dash Line?我们可以使用SimpleLineSymbol实现这一目标吗?

问题描述 投票:0回答:1

示例:--------------这里有红色和黄色的备用仪表板。

javascript gis esri esri-javascript-api
1个回答
0
投票

您可以根据具体条件着色线条。

routeSymbols = {
          "Route 1": new SimpleLineSymbol().setColor(new Color([0,0,255,0.5])).setWidth(5),
          "Route 2": new SimpleLineSymbol().setColor(new Color([0,255,0,0.5])).setWidth(5),
          "Route 3": new SimpleLineSymbol().setColor(new Color([255,0,255,0.5])).setWidth(5)
        };

//Three different drawings can be made. 
map.graphics.add(routeResult.route.setSymbol(routeSymbols[routeResult.routeName]))
© www.soinside.com 2019 - 2024. All rights reserved.